John Hom is an American professional poker player from San Rafael, California, with over $979.6K in live tournament earnings. His best live cash of $174,840 came when he won his first bracelet at the 33rd WSOP in April 2002.

John Hom: Live Tournament Participation

John Hom recorded his first live cash in June 1994. He participated in a $500 + 30 Limit Hold’em
during the California State Poker Championship in Los Angeles. He placed 9th and cashed $1,132.

In August 1995, John played in a $1,000 + 50 No Limit Hold’em during the Legends of Poker in Los Angeles. He finished in 2nd place and earned $37,950.

During the 28th World Series of Poker in Las Vegas in May 1997, he achieved 2nd place. He took part in a $3,000 Omaha 8 or Better and took home $72,600.

Following this, in November 2001, he entered the $500 + 40 No Limit Hold’em at the United States Poker Championship in Atlantic City. John clinched victory and won $40,515.

On April 30th, 2002, John played in a $3,000 Limit Hold’em at the 33rd WSOP. He clinched another victory and won his biggest live cash of $174,840.

At the World Poker Challenge in Reno in March 2007, he cashed for $136,695. John participated in a $5,000 + 150 No Limit Hold’em – Championship Event and secured 5th place.

Most recently, in February 2020, he competed in a $400 No Limit Hold’em – Double Stack Event #10 at the WSOP Circuit in Rio Las Vegas. He placed 40th and cashed $569.
